Question - A magazine is facing dwindling subscriptions and is thinking about closing down its team responsible for restaurant reviews to cut costs. It currently writes between 900 to 1,100 reviews a year. The team consists of one senior journalist with a permanent employment at the magazine, who would likely be reassigned within the company after the closure. Her yearly salary cost is £60,000. Moreover, the team employs one part time journalists on hourly contract that on average is costing the magazine £40,000 a year. The team's office space is allocated a facility cost of £12,000 a year and the team spend on average about £50,000 on travel and restaurant expenses a year. Instead of having the team, the magazine would then buy restaurant reviews from a third-party provider at a cost of £140 per review. How much will the magazine save per year if it closes its team?

A. Costs decrease between £9,000 to £11,000 per year

B. Costs neither increase nor decrease

C. Costs decrease between £19,800 to £24,200 per year

D. Costs increase between £45,000 to £55,000 per year

E. Costs increase between £81,000 to £99,000 per year
